Easy Guide To Start Windows XP/Vista/7 into Safe Mode with Networking

Step 1. Click Start and select Restart from Power option and then during restarting process keep tapping F8 button continuously.
Step 2. Next, Advanced Boot Option appears on your PC screen. Now you should use arrow key to select Safe Mode with Networking and hit enter to reboot your PC in Safe Mode.

Easy Guide To Start Windows 8.1/10 into Safe Mode with Networking

Step 1. First Click Start then hold the Shift button, click Restart from Power option.
Step 2. Choose Troubleshoot option and then click Advanced options.
Step 3. Next, Tap on Startup Settings and click Restart.
Step 4. After you PC restarts, To turn on your PC into Safe Mode with Networking feature you need to press 5 numeric button on your keyboard.

Easy Guide To Open Task Manager on Windows XP/Vista/7/8.1/10

Step 1. Press Windows logo button+ R together to open Run Box.
Step 2. Next, type 'taskmgr' and hit Enter button to open Task Manager.

Step 3. Click Processes Tab and see running task list find MSIL.Trojan-Ransom.Cryptear.R related processes or other suspicious process.
Step 4. Now, right click on the process that you want to terminate and click End task.
